如何将Excel文件作为任务或作业运行?

时间:2011-11-18 21:46:13

标签: excel vba excel-vba excel-2010

是否可以安排Excel文件在某一天运行?

我有一个我从数据刷新的文件。我使用单元格作为参数来填充数据Feed。我想看看是否有办法设置作业自动运行并保存它们。如果可能的话,用Excel中的单元格保存它们。

有什么想法吗?

2 个答案:

答案 0 :(得分:6)

使用Windows计划程序安排任务以打开Excel文件。然后,您应该能够使用Workbook_Open事件来执行文件所需的操作。

答案 1 :(得分:4)

正如Danny和Adil B指出的那样,您可以使用Windows Scheduler来安排事件。但我通常计划运行vbs脚本来操作Excel,而不是直接打开Excel - 如果这是一个问题,这种方法可以更好地控制宏安全设置

有关使用Windows Scheduler安排vbs的信息,请参阅this example

您的数据Feed如何运行,是否需要此部分的帮助?